Transaction 034932100abc589b4ed23476da4a66ea3653d12ed061e399dc381d243be3fe1e
1 Input
1 Output
-
034932100abc589b4ed23476da4a66ea3653d12ed061e399dc381d243be3fe1e:0
- value
- 566791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e25925ea2bf7d2375d1aa072e26c402629265a64 OP_EQUAL
- address
- 3NKqS1u8oang5tnUuV94QckVYfdVRWdq7R